
When the Taliban came to her valley, they said people mustn’t listen to music, women must wear burqas and girls must not go to school. Malala wrote blogs and spoke on the radio and the television about her dream and the dream of her friends to go to school. When she was just 15 years old the Taliban shot her, but she did not die and continues to work for girls’ education in all the countries of the world.
